Route Overview & Local Insights

This 5.4km loop through the Knock of Crieff offers a quintessential Scottish trail running experience, blending crisp woodland air with a steady 163m of ascent. Starting from Knock Road, runners will encounter a mix of paved sections and rugged forest paths as they navigate the slopes of Culcrieff Wood. Classified as a hilly route, the climb is challenging yet rewarding, featuring a relatively short distance that makes it perfect for a vigorous morning workout or a fast-paced tempo session. The terrain is varied underfoot, requiring a bit of focus on the trail sections, but the breathtaking panoramic views across Strathearn from the summit are well worth the elevation gain.

Crieff has long been a destination for those seeking the restorative powers of the Highlands, famously known as the home of the Crieff Hydro and a historic cattle-droving crossroads. Running this loop feels like stepping into a piece of Perthshire history; the "Knock" itself is a prominent wooded hill that has served as a landmark for centuries. As you traverse Culcrieff Wood, you are running through a landscape that transitioned from ancient hunting grounds to a Victorian-era retreat. The area’s unique microclimate often keeps these trails runnable year-round, making it a favorite local spot for hill runners looking to escape the busier routes in nearby Stirling or Perth.
